Exports by Country

Uzbekistan dominates exports structure, reaching X tons, which was approx. 98% of total exports in 2021. Tajikistan (X tons) followed a long way behind the leaders.

Uzbekistan was also the fastest-growing in terms of the dried onions exports, with a CAGR of +249.7% from 2012 to 2021. Tajikistan (-3.0%) illustrated a downward trend over the same period. While the share of Uzbekistan (+98 p.p.) increased significantly in terms of the total exports from 2012-2021, the share of Tajikistan (-96.1 p.p.) displayed negative dynamics.

In value terms, Uzbekistan ($X) remains the largest dried onion supplier in Central Asia, comprising 91% of total exports. The second position in the ranking was held by Tajikistan ($X), with a 5.6% share of total exports.

From 2012 to 2021, the average annual growth rate of value in Uzbekistan stood at +151.8%.

Imports by Country

The purchases of the one major importers of dried onions, namely Kazakhstan, represented more than two-thirds of total import.

Kazakhstan was also the fastest-growing in terms of the dried onions imports, with a CAGR of +9.1% from 2012 to 2021. From 2012 to 2021, the share of Kazakhstan increased by +2.5 percentage points, while the shares of the other countries remained relatively stable throughout the analyzed period.

In value terms, Kazakhstan ($X) constitutes the largest market for imported dried onions in Central Asia.

In Kazakhstan, dried onion imports expanded at an average annual rate of +7.2% over the period from 2012-2021.
